Distance from Magong to Haifenglun

The distance from Magong to Haifenglun is approximately 101 km / 63 mi (as the crow flies).

The following map shows the distance from Magong to Haifenglun.

For more detailed information about any of the places please click on the place name:
Magong
Haifenglun

Map options

Current distance: Magong -> Haifenglun
Show reverse: Haifenglun -> Magong

DistanceRouteRoute by bikeRoute by foot